原文:js對手機軟鍵盤的監聽

js還沒有辦法對手機軟鍵盤直接進行監聽的,但是可以有其他角度來判斷軟鍵盤是否彈起。比如輸入框是否獲取焦點等。focusin和focusout支持冒泡,對應focus和blur, 使用focusin和focusout的原因是focusin和focusout可以冒泡,focus和blur不會冒泡,這樣就可以使用事件代理,處理多個輸入框存在的情況。 但是,實際中發現這種方法僅在ios上有效,鍵盤彈出和鍵 ...

2019-01-15 11:35 0 995 推薦指數:

查看詳情

js對手機軟鍵盤監聽

js還沒有辦法對手機軟鍵盤直接進行監聽的,但是可以有其他角度來判斷軟鍵盤是否彈起。比如輸入框是否獲取焦點等。focusin和focusout支持冒泡,對應focus和blur, 使用focusin和focusout的原因是focusin和focusout可以冒泡,focus和blur不會冒泡 ...

Wed Jun 14 03:48:00 CST 2017 0 12193
JS 解決安卓手機輸入框被軟鍵盤遮住的問題

安卓手機輸入框被軟鍵盤遮住的問題,如何在點擊輸入框的時候類似與IOS那種,輸入框直接在軟件盤的上面,而不會被遮住 在代碼中加入如下代碼: ...

Sun May 17 01:43:00 CST 2020 0 844
手機軟鍵盤彈起導致頁面變形的一種解決方案

最近用 uniapp(一種第三方 app 開發框架) 開發 app,其中一個頁面有十幾個 input 輸入框,在點擊 input 輸入時,軟鍵盤彈起,導致頁面往上頂,底部的按鈕也全部彈到頁面上面去了,布局全被打亂。 原來的樣子: 軟鍵盤彈出來后: 在開發APP時,通常情況下頁面的寬度和高度 ...

Tue Apr 23 22:17:00 CST 2019 0 1174
防止手機頁面軟鍵盤調出時布局被擠壓

填寫表單時會調出手機上面的軟鍵盤,若body是按照百分比做自適應布局會擠壓布局(iphone人家就好好着呢)。解決方法:1、將表單內容按照px定寬高。2、整個表單form絕對定位(盡量保證各表單位置不變)3、form里面的元素相對定位,上下的間隔使用margin-top4、以上保證表單不會擠壓變形 ...

Tue Nov 24 21:29:00 CST 2015 0 17238
如何設置手機軟鍵盤右下角的文字?

問題:移動端,點擊輸入,軟鍵盤出來后,怎么把 “換行” 變為 “確認” 或 “前往” 之類的字段啊 解決辦法:把input的type屬性設置為text (type="text") ...

Sat Mar 27 00:36:00 CST 2021 0 345
關於移動端H5手機軟鍵盤調起事件

參考效果如圖 有個問題就是底欄一般都是fixed定位的,鍵盤調起的時候元素也會被頂起來,我要做的跟上兩張圖的效果相反,就是當鍵盤調起時隱藏元素,鍵盤消失時顯示,因為拿不到系統鍵盤的對應事件,用window的resize事件解決,系統鍵盤調起消失會觸發這個事件,但是android微信下測試 ...

Sat Jul 08 00:06:00 CST 2017 0 4977
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M